For Amy Meredith, advocacy is personal. From a free-range 1980s childhood to becoming a first-generation college graduate, guardian to her younger sister, and a nonprofit co-founder and Executive Director, her life has been shaped by resilience and purpose.Behind those achievements, a deeper journey was unfolding. After becoming alcohol-free in 2020, Amy began to unearth the truth she had long masked: she was neurodivergent, carrying sensory, emotional, and social complexities she had spent decades hiding. As the world moved through seasons of upheaval, grief, and transformation, she answered her own call-to live, lead, and heal with full authenticity.With honesty and heart, she takes readers inside building a nonprofit from the ground up, leading through a pandemic, and championing epilepsy and neurodiversity awareness. This is a story of courage, community, and the transformative power of storytelling to spark change.
